package k8s
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"strings"
"github.com/pkg/errors"
v1 "k8s.io/api/core/v1"
"github.com/windmilleng/tilt/internal/container"
"github.com/windmilleng/tilt/internal/logger"
)
const ContainerIDPrefix = "docker://"
func WaitForContainerReady(ctx context.Context, client Client, pod *v1.Pod, ref container.RefSelector) (v1.ContainerStatus, error) {
cStatus, err := waitForContainerReadyHelper(pod, ref)
if err != nil {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, err
} else if cStatus != (v1.ContainerStatus{}) {
return cStatus, nil
}
watch, err := client.WatchPod(ctx, pod)
if err != nil {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, errors.Wrap(err, "WaitForContainerReady")
}
defer watch.Stop()
for {
select {
case <-ctx.Done():
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, errors.Wrap(ctx.Err(), "WaitForContainerReady")
case event, ok := <-watch.ResultChan():
if !ok {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, fmt.Errorf("Container watch closed: %s", ref)
}
obj := event.Object
pod, ok := obj.(*v1.Pod)
if !ok {
logger.Get(ctx).Debugf("Unexpected watch notification: %T", obj)
continue
}
FixContainerStatusImages(pod)
cStatus, err := waitForContainerReadyHelper(pod, ref)
if err != nil {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, err
} else if cStatus != (v1.ContainerStatus{}) {
return cStatus, nil
}
}
}
}
func waitForContainerReadyHelper(pod *v1.Pod, ref container.RefSelector) (v1.ContainerStatus, error) {
cStatus, err := ContainerMatching(pod, ref)
if err != nil {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, errors.Wrap(err, "WaitForContainerReadyHelper")
}
unschedulable, msg := IsUnschedulable(pod.Status)
if unschedulable {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, fmt.Errorf("Container will never be ready: %s", msg)
}
if IsContainerExited(pod.Status, cStatus) {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, fmt.Errorf("Container will never be ready: %s", ref)
}
if !cStatus.Ready {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, nil
}
return cStatus, nil
}
// If true, this means the container is gone and will never recover.
func IsContainerExited(pod v1.PodStatus, container v1.ContainerStatus) bool {
if pod.Phase == v1.PodSucceeded || pod.Phase == v1.PodFailed {
return true
}
if container.State.Terminated != nil {
return true
}
return false
}
// Returns the error message if the pod is unschedulable
func IsUnschedulable(pod v1.PodStatus) (bool, string) {
for _, cond := range pod.Conditions {
if cond.Reason == v1.PodReasonUnschedulable {
return true, cond.Message
}
}
return false, ""
}
// Kubernetes has a bug where the image ref in the container status
// can be wrong (though this does not mean the container is running
// unexpected code)
//
// Repro steps:
// 1) Create an image and give it two different tags (A and B)
// 2) Deploy Pods with both A and B in the pod spec
// 3) The PodStatus will choose A or B for both pods.
//
// More details here:
// https://github.com/kubernetes/kubernetes/issues/51017
//
// For Tilt, it's pretty important that the image tag is correct (for matching
// purposes). To work around this bug, we change the image reference in
// ContainerStatus to match the ContainerSpec.
func FixContainerStatusImages(pod *v1.Pod) {
refsByContainerName := make(map[string]string)
for _, c := range pod.Spec.Containers {
if c.Name != "" {
refsByContainerName[c.Name] = c.Image
}
}
for i, cs := range pod.Status.ContainerStatuses {
image, ok := refsByContainerName[cs.Name]
if !ok {
continue
}
cs.Image = image
pod.Status.ContainerStatuses[i] = cs
}
}
func ContainerMatching(pod *v1.Pod, ref container.RefSelector) (v1.ContainerStatus, error) {
for _, c := range pod.Status.ContainerStatuses {
cRef, err := container.ParseNamed(c.Image)
if err != nil {
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, errors.Wrap(err, "ContainerMatching")
}
if ref.Matches(cRef) {
return c, nil
}
}
return v1.ContainerStatus{}, nil
}
func ContainerIDFromContainerStatus(status v1.ContainerStatus) (container.ID, error) {
id := status.ContainerID
if id == "" {
return "", nil
}
components := strings.SplitN(id, "://", 2)
if len(components) != 2 {
return "", fmt.Errorf("Malformed container ID: %s", id)
}
return container.ID(components[1]), nil
}
func ContainerNameFromContainerStatus(status v1.ContainerStatus) container.Name {
return container.Name(status.Name)
}
func ContainerSpecOf(pod *v1.Pod, status v1.ContainerStatus) v1.Container {
for _, spec := range pod.Spec.Containers {
if spec.Name == status.Name {
return spec
}
}
return v1.Container{}
}
